Architecture Organométallique et Catalyse


Our research aims to design new organometallic species presenting unusual coordination modes and to look for interesting catalytic applications. One main area concerns the chemistry of organometallic complexes containing ? H-E bonds (E = H, C, Si, B). Mechanistic investigations are at the heart of our research to understand how to improve selectivity or achieve better activity, two major goals in catalysis.
